Considered essential for those who are also taking one or more of the sciences at A Level, A Level Mathematics pairs well with a wide range of subjects. It supports careers in medicine, scientific research, business, finance, and engineering. The skills developed through studying mathematics are highly valued across various fields, making this course an excellent choice for students with diverse academic interests and career aspirations.
A Level Mathematics topics include:
- Calculus - differentiation and integration techniques and applications
- Trigonometry - graphs, equations and identities
- Algebra - working with a variety of functions to solve problems
- Proof - meeting new methods of proving (or disproving) statements
- Mechanics - understanding how objects move and the forces involved
- Statistics - dealing with data, probability distributions and hypothesis testing.
A Level Mathematics is a challenging and rewarding course which will enable you to work to a high standard and support you in developing higher-level problem-solving skills. You will find that your algebraic skills develop rapidly as you tackle interesting and varied problems. We will support you in structuring your revision to help achieve your full potential.
You will be offered additional opportunities throughout the course. You could be invited to go to university problem-solving days, take part in the Senior Maths Challenge and participate in mentoring schemes with other college or university students. There will also be careers and apprenticeship talks to provide ideas for future pathways.
A minimum of five GCSEs at grade 4 or above including English Language and a grade 6 or above in GCSE Maths.
You will have a 9.55am start, one lesson in the morning, one in the afternoon and a guaranteed 4pm finish. You will also have at least one morning and one afternoon per week free for private study.
You will take three exams, which you will sit at the end of your second year.
Maths is a subject that will open many doors for you in the future. You could go on to a career in medicine, banking, data analysis, business, architecture and many more.
